Situational analysis of health surveillance at the human-wildlife interface for preventing zoonoses in Côte d’Ivoire
Key messages<br/>
<ul>
<li>Health monitoring programs exist for human, animal, and environment but are discipline specific. </li>
<li>Lack of integrated surveillance systems and scarce wildlife monitoring. </li>
